New partnership plans green data centre in Malysia

New partnership plans green data centre in Malysia

Key ASIC, a Malaysian semiconductor and energy-efficient ASIC design specialist, and CT Vision, an investment and green technology group, have signed a memorandum of understanding (MoU) for a partnership to develop a large-scale, fully integrated green AI data centre (AIDC) complex in Malaysia.

The project will encompass the design, construction, ownership and operation of on-site and associated renewable energy assets, including solar, wind and other complementary clean energy sources, to provide reliable, low-carbon electricity directly to the data centre. This integrated model enables dedicated clean energy generation to support the AIDC’s operations.

The facility has a planned total IT load of approximately 300MW within five years of its launch and will be purpose built for AI and machine learning workloads, as well as supercomputing and enterprise cloud services.

The project is targeting 100% renewable energy penetration with around 50% self-generated on-site/associated green power, and a power usage effectiveness (PUE) ratio of less than or equal to 1.20, which, the partners say, significantly exceeds global and regional sustainability benchmarks.

Mr Eg Kah Yee, Executive Chairman and CEO of Key ASIC Berhad, explains: “This partnership represents a paradigm shift: we are not merely constructing a data centre, but building a green energy-to-AI ecosystem. By building and generating our own green energy specifically for AIDC use, we achieve exceptional energy security, long-term cost competitiveness and full ESG accountability.

Lian Mingcheng, executive director of CT Vision, adds: “Malaysia offers outstanding renewable resources, strategic geographic location and stable policy environment – ideal for next-generation AI infrastructure.”

The MoU includes a ten-year confidentiality clause. It's not yet clear where in the country the complex is to be built. However, feasibility studies, site planning, and engineering and commercial structuring are planned to take place by the end of the year.
